Atara Biotherapeutics Inc

HEALTHCARE · BIOTECHNOLOGY · USA

Atara Biotherapeutics, Inc., a commercially available T-cell immunotherapy company, develops treatments for cancer patients, autoimmune and viral diseases in the United States. The company is headquartered in South San Francisco, California.

Johnson & Johnson

HEALTHCARE · DRUG MANUFACTURERS - GENERAL · USA

Johnson & Johnson (J&J) is an American multinational corporation founded in 1886 that develops medical devices, pharmaceuticals, and consumer packaged goods. Its common stock is a component of the Dow Jones Industrial Average and the company is ranked No. 36 on the 2021 Fortune 500 list of the largest United States corporations by total revenue. Johnson & Johnson is one of the world's most valuable companies, and is one of only two U.S.-based companies that has a prime credit rating of AAA, higher than that of the United States government.
